  4. I am marrying a 28 y.o. TG from Issan in a couple of months. She speaks perfect English, has a university degree but comes from an Issan farming family. We have also applied for a fiancée visa and will have a small ceremony followed by a bigger reception in the United States. The traditional Thai wedding in Issan is for her family and friends, and will not be registered for months (so as not to screw up our visa application). Suffice it to say I am concerned that the cost of the two ceremonies and travel expenses are already going to be very expensive without the little extras I am told are required in a Thai traditional marriage. I am wondering if the costs that my fiancée proposes for the Thai wedding are reasonable. While my in-laws do not want a dowry (they are apparently happy that their daughter and I are in love), my fiancée indicates that a present from me to them s appropriate. She proposes that I give her parents a gift of 8-10 cows or buffalo for the farm (approximately B150k or US 4,500). Additionally she proposes that I give her 10 baht of gold (approximately B120K or US 3,400); pay for wedding outfits and photos (B50k or US 1500); and pay for the ceremony and reception at a hotel for 150 - 200 guests (approximately B75K or US 2,100). Grand total is approximately B495K or US 12,400 for the Thai wedding alone. Additionally, she wants me to put up B200K for show money which will be returned after the ceremony and reception.

    I think that 2 to 4 Buffalos or cows are generous and reasonable, as is 3 to 6 baht of gold. I do not know whether the costs for the photos or ceremony are unreasonable although I suspect they are ok (although the photos and outfits are already a done deal since I already told her that it was ok). Overall, I think that what she proposes might be too much? Any thoughts, comments or advice would be appreciated.

    BTW the US ceremony and reception will be approximately US 5,000 to 7, 000 (not including the travel expenses).
